Mastering Emotional Intelligence: Practical Strategies for Personal & Professional Growth

Cultivating Emotional Intelligence: A Comprehensive Approach

Emotional intelligence (EI), a multifaceted construct encompassing the ability to perceive, understand, manage, and utilize emotions (Mayer & Salovey, 1997), is increasingly recognized as a crucial determinant of personal and professional success. This article provides a structured framework for cultivating EI, drawing upon established theories and models in psychology and organizational behavior. We will explore practical strategies grounded in real-world application, emphasizing the importance of self-awareness, social skills, and self-regulation.

1. Self-Awareness: The Foundation of Emotional Intelligence. Understanding one's own emotions, strengths, and weaknesses forms the cornerstone of EI. This involves introspection, utilizing techniques like journaling or mindfulness to identify emotional triggers and patterns. The Johari Window model provides a valuable framework for understanding the relationship between self-perception and how others perceive us, highlighting blind spots that may hinder effective self-management. Developing self-awareness requires consistent self-reflection and a willingness to confront uncomfortable truths about oneself.

2. Goal Setting and Self-Regulation: Directing Emotional Energy. Goal-setting theory posits that specific, measurable, achievable, relevant, and time-bound (SMART) goals enhance motivation and performance. Applying this to EI development involves setting realistic targets for improving self-awareness, managing stress, and enhancing communication skills. Self-regulation, encompassing the ability to control impulses and adapt to changing circumstances, is crucial. Techniques such as cognitive reframing (Beck's Cognitive Therapy), which involves challenging negative thought patterns, and mindfulness meditation can significantly improve self-regulation.

3. Empathetic Engagement: Building Strong Relationships. Empathy, the capacity to understand and share the feelings of others, is a pivotal component of EI. Perspective-taking, a core element of empathy, involves actively trying to understand others' viewpoints and experiences. This can be facilitated through active listening, a skill that requires focused attention, verbal and nonverbal cues interpretation, and thoughtful responses. Social Cognitive Theory highlights the role of observational learning and modeling in acquiring social skills, suggesting that observing and emulating individuals skilled in empathy can accelerate development in this area.

4. Effective Communication: Conveying Emotions Accurately. Clear and concise communication, crucial for fostering positive relationships, requires both verbal and nonverbal proficiency. Nonverbal communication, including body language and tone of voice, significantly impacts message reception. The transactional analysis model can help individuals understand communication patterns and identify potential barriers to effective interaction, leading to improvements in expressing oneself and understanding others' perspectives.

5. Stress Management and Resilience: Navigating Challenges. Stress significantly impacts emotional well-being and can hinder the development of EI. Effective stress management techniques, including mindfulness, relaxation exercises, and regular physical activity, are crucial. Resilience, the ability to bounce back from adversity, is also essential. This can be fostered by cultivating a growth mindset (Dweck's theory of Mindset), viewing setbacks as learning opportunities, and building a supportive social network.

6. Continuous Learning and Growth: A Lifelong Pursuit. EI development is an ongoing process. Actively seeking feedback, participating in workshops, and engaging in self-help resources can significantly enhance EI. This continuous learning approach aligns with the concept of lifelong learning, reflecting a commitment to personal and professional growth.

7. Cultivating Optimism and Gratitude: Shifting Perspective. Positive psychology emphasizes the role of optimism and gratitude in fostering well-being. By focusing on positive aspects of life and practicing gratitude, individuals can cultivate a more positive emotional climate. Learned optimism (Seligman's Learned Optimism) suggests that optimism can be cultivated through targeted interventions, leading to improved emotional regulation and resilience.
